I believe it was 6/15 when I applied online for the targeted United Explorer card.

I wasn't sure if I hit the 5/24. One of my new cards in the last 24 months was a downgrade from Ink Plus to Ink Cash so if that counted, I'd be right at 5/24.

I unfroze with Experian only, though I'd seen posts indicating that Chase was pulling Experian and Equifax.

I got a letter in the mail dated 6/16 saying they needed me to lift the freeze with Equinox, so pretty quick response. I don't know why they couldn't just use email though, as that would have been quicker.

I unfroze Equifax and then I called the toll free number for Lending Services (888-270-2127, 8-20:00 M-F). I thought it was only going to be to let them know that they can pull Equifax but she put me on hold and they did the pull.

Then she came back and asked a couple of more income verification and mortgage payments questions.

Then another hold and then she says she'd be likely to approve but I'd have to move credit around so I reduced a lot of excess credit on two Chase cards and she approved.

She said 1-2 weeks, can't expedite or send the card by express services because their partner United has to go through the process of linking the accounts.

Asked about whether I'd have any problem getting the promo (I got the promo in 2012, then canceled the card, then got a targeted offer in early 2014, got the card then told I wouldn't get the promo so I canceled it then. The second cancellation may have been within the 24-month period). She didn't directly say it but implied that she wouldn't have approved the card if I wasn't going to get the promo. Instead the welcome letter should spell it out.
